LISTEN: New Franz Ferdinand and Sparks track
Another knowing song from FFS.
June 5 sees the Domino release of FFS, the debut album of the arty rock supergroup of the same name, consisting of the members of Franz Ferdinand and Sparks.
We've already had the delightful 'Piss Off' and 'Johnny Delusional' and today comes the low key, wryl-titled 'Collaborations Don't Work'. We beg to disagree. Listen below.
"We approached it the way bands do with their first," Alex Kapranos has said. "We had the songs first, rehearsed them and then recorded it all together, in a room. So no hanging around or fannying about.
"The real motivation was to make something new, not ‘Franz featuring Russell Mael’, or ‘Sparks with Franz Ferdinand backing them.'"
